If you are undergoing medical treatment to control your blood pressure, please keep a record of
the level of your blood pressure by carrying out regular self-measurements at specific times of
the day. Show these values to your doctor. Never use the results of your measurements to
alter independently the drug doses prescribed by your doctor.

The higher value is the one that determines the evaluation. Example: a readout value between
150/85 or 120/98 mmHg indicates «blood pressure too high».
☞ Further information
• If your values are mostly standard under resting conditions but exceptionally high under
conditions of physical or psychological stress, it is possible that you are suffering from so- called
«labile hypertension». Please consult your doctor if you suspect that this might be the case.
• Correctly measured diastolic blood-pressure values above 120mmHg require immediate
medical treatment.
